An internship at IFAD offers a unique learning experience to recent graduates or students specializing in areas relevant to our mission. That’s why IFAD offers six-month internship opportunities to recent university graduates or current students specializing in areas of work relevant to IFAD’s mission. Interns may pursue an additional six-month internship, accessing a different learning experience and broadening their exposure to IFAD’s areas of work.
ELIGIBILITY:
Be 30 years of age or younger.
Be enrolled in an accredited university or graduate school, have completed at least two years of undergraduate studies and have attended courses in the last 24 months; or have completed university studies at an undergraduate or postgraduate level within the last 24 months.
Be fluent in English. Knowledge of another IFAD official language (Arabic, French or Spanish) and/or any other language may be necessary, depending on the region of assignment.
BENEFIT:
The internship programme provides a monthly allowance. Moreover, to further promote geographic diversity, IFAD offers a higher monthly allowance (contributing to housing and travel expenses) to interns from developing countries who need to travel to their duty station.
For International Students who wish to enroll in the first year of a postgraduate degree without a restricted number of places taught in English listed in this call. The scholarship awarded is incompatible with any other scholarship granted by the Italian government or by Italian or foreign institutions, including those of the regional right to study (EDISU). Student beneficiaries are obliged, on their own responsibility, to inform the International Students Office if they are awarded other scholarships.
ELIGIBILITY:
To participate in the selection, candidates must meet the following requirements:
have obtained, at an institution outside the Italian system, a degree valid for access to the chosen postgraduate degree, or obtain it by the deadline for enrolment at the University of Turin;
meet the requirements for admission to the chosen course (check the admission requirements for the course of interest at apply.unito.it);
have submitted their application for a maximum of 2 (two) courses of interest on the apply.unito.it platform from 26 November 2024 to 30 January 2025;
be proficient in English at least the B2 level of the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ages.
BENEFIT:
The total amount of the scholarship is €20,000.00 gross. Any tax charges incurred by the recipient (€10,000 for each academic year).
